Connect the USB A2 adapter directly to a high-power USB port on the PC. Avoid using unpowered USB hubs, as the adapter draws significant current to power its internal MPI/PROFIBUS optocouplers. Issue 3: Virtual Machine Connection Dropouts Click the

The Siemens PC Adapter USB A2 (6GK1571-0BA00-0AA0) connects laptops via USB to SIMATIC S7-300 and S7-400 PLCs over MPI or PROFIBUS networks.
